If you’re looking to dive deep into the fascinating world of fluid power, the ‘Fundamentals of Fluid Power’ course on Coursera is an exceptional starting point. This online course serves as a comprehensive introduction to the principles and applications of fluid power, providing the skills necessary to analyze and design fluid power systems in a variety of applications.

The course is structured over six weeks, with each week focusing on key concepts and components of fluid power systems. Here’s a breakdown of what you can expect:

  • Week 1: Fundamentals of Fluid Power – This introductory week lays the foundation by exploring hydraulics and pneumatics and the fundamental concepts through cylinders.
  • Week 2: Components and Concepts – Part 1 – Students will learn about circuit diagrams and the flow of fluids through conduits.
  • Week 3: Components and Concepts – Part 2 – Dive deeper into valves and pumps, understanding their function and significance in hydraulic circuits.
  • Week 4: Predicting Performance Through Simulation – Gain hands-on experience with Simscape Fluids for simulating fluid systems, enhancing your problem-solving skills.
  • Week 5: Fluid Properties – Discover how the properties of hydraulic fluids affect circuit operation, exploring phenomena like the water hammer effect.
  • Week 6: Advanced Components and Systems – Wrap-up the course by learning about advanced components such as accumulators and servo valves, and apply your knowledge in simulations.
